By Alex Murray Writer Is Oliver M. Smith-Kawenni:io creating a lacrosse dynasty? It certainly seems like it, as they emerged victorious in the junior Six Nations School Lacrosse Tournament on June 9 after winning the intermediate tourney the week before. Because of construction on the blue track where the tournament is normally held, the co-ed event, which has been a Six Nations tradition for decades, was hosted at the Iroquois Lacrosse Arena. Teams played a combination of box and field lacrosse in 20-minute games that featured two 10-minute halves. While the primary lacrosse tournament had five teams and the intermediate had just three plus one combination team last week, the junior bracket was filled to the brim.
